Output 456859017584f326b37e5d906037530e69ea7573e53aac5896e8dff903bb4809:3

value
8539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6791340d339d779d353bb736194fc046da4fe9e OP_EQUAL
address
3GsF8qhnuGYypcn9PdBJiZxaHmbcKv9RXn
transaction
456859017584f326b37e5d906037530e69ea7573e53aac5896e8dff903bb4809
spent
true